Jio launches new mobile plan offering 33% more data

Reliance Jio has launched a new plan, offering 33 percent more data than existing industry tariffs – targeting work from home (WFH) customers.
Jio chat for IndiaThe new plan costing Rs 2,399 per year provides 2 GB of data per day, with an effective price of Rs 200 per month. The plan comes with unlimited voice and SMS, and 365-day validity, Jio said in a statement on Friday.

Jio’s existing long-term plan is priced at Rs 2,121 that offers data of 1.5 GB per day and comes with 336-day validity.

The telecom operator also launched new top-up WFH plan of Rs 151 with 30 GB data, Rs 201 with 40 GB data and Rs 251 with 50 GB data.
